[ITEM 3] QUESTION: Kitchen renovation: how to plan outlets and lighting for appliances?

Answer

Competent distribution of electrical outlets and thoughtful lighting are the basis of safety and comfort in a modern kitchen, where many powerful household appliances are used. The professional answer regarding kitchen renovation states that you must first resolve safety and engineering communication issues, such as electricity, water, and ventilation, and only then proceed to finishing and decorative design. This sequential approach minimizes the number of hidden problems and avoids chasing already finished walls to lay a forgotten cable.

A modern kitchen requires a huge number of connection points, because in addition to the refrigerator, stove, and range hood, a microwave oven, dishwasher, kettle, coffee maker, toaster, and various small gadgets are constantly running. All high-power appliances must have separate lines in the electrical panel with circuit breakers and RCDs installed to prevent overloads and short circuits. At the design stage, it is important to clearly know the dimensions and location of the appliances so that outlets do not end up behind appliance bodies or in direct water exposure zones.

Kitchen lighting should be multi-level and functional, divided into general, task, and accent lighting. General light provides uniform space filling, task lighting is mounted under wall cabinets to illuminate the countertop, and decorative light emphasizes the beauty of the backsplash or dining area. For convenience, switches and outlets for the working area are best placed at a comfortable height of about fifteen to twenty centimeters above the countertop, avoiding installation near the cooktop and sink.

Careful planning of the electrical network on paper with the involvement of a qualified specialist guarantees the uninterrupted operation of all electrical appliances and your personal safety. Make sure you provide a few extra outlets for the future, as over time the number of kitchen helpers in your home will inevitably increase. By following these engineering rules, you will create a reliable base for the comfortable use of the space without the risk of emergency situations.
